Retro Replay Review
Gameplay
The Amazing Virtual Sea-Monkeys places you in charge of a miniature aquatic ecosystem, tasking you with nurturing creatures hatched from a packet of “Instant Life.” At its core, gameplay revolves around feeding your Sea-Monkeys and ensuring adequate oxygen levels in the tank. These simple mechanics create a steady rhythm: check on your pets, watch them grow, and address any environmental needs before they become critical. This casual caretaking loop is soothing rather than stressful, making the game ideal for players looking to unwind.

As your Sea-Monkeys mature, they begin to collect pearls scattered throughout their habitat. Gathering these pearls adds a light sense of progression and encourages you to interact more frequently with the tank. Spent pearls unlock a variety of add-ons—everything from decorative plants to playful toys and colorful fish companions. While there’s no strict win condition, the collectible economy gives you a tangible goal: curate the most vibrant, happy ecosystem you can imagine.
Interaction is largely point-and-click, true to its Creatures-series heritage but without the deep AI complexity. You simply select items—food, oxygen bubbles, or toys—from a toolbar and apply them to the tank or directly to your Sea-Monkeys. This mouse-driven interface is intuitive even for newcomers, though veterans of more intricate pet sims might find the lack of advanced controls a bit limiting. Still, for those seeking a low-pressure simulation, it hits the mark perfectly.
Graphics
Visually, The Amazing Virtual Sea-Monkeys opts for a colorful, cartoon-like aesthetic that feels both nostalgic and fresh. The tank is rendered with smooth gradients and lively water effects that simulate gentle currents and bubbles rising to the surface. Each Sea-Monkey character boasts a charming design—big eyes, expressive movements, and a whimsical sense of scale that makes them endlessly endearing.
The environmental details deserve special mention. From vibrant aquatic plants swaying in the water to the subtle glint of pearls hidden among the sand, the game creates a visually rich microcosm. Add-ons like coral clusters, seaweed fronds, and miniature castles further liven up the scene, giving players a variety of visual choices to personalize their tank. Frame rates remain stable even as the tank becomes crowded, a testament to the optimized engine drawn from the Creatures series.
While the graphics aren’t pushing the boundaries of next-gen realism, they achieve something arguably more valuable: personality. The deliberate color palette and friendly animations reinforce the game’s relaxing tone. Whether viewed on a laptop or a larger desktop screen, the presentation remains crisp, and the interface elements are cleanly integrated without obscuring the aquatic world you’re shaping.
Story
In a genre often dominated by epic narratives or branching quests, The Amazing Virtual Sea-Monkeys takes a minimalist approach. There’s no overarching plot or characters to follow; instead, the game provides an open-ended premise—bring a packet of “Instant Life” to your digital tank and watch it flourish. This lack of a scripted storyline is by design, letting players forge their own pet-care narratives through daily interactions.
The backstory is light but evocative. Referencing the real-world novelty of Sea-Monkeys, the game taps into nostalgia while creating its own charming lore. As your virtual creatures develop, you’re encouraged to invent your own tales—did a Sea-Monkey just discover a hidden pearl trove? Has one grown particularly adventurous? These small moments become the stories you tell, giving the game surprising emotional depth despite its simple framework.
Because there are no cutscenes or dialogue trees, the narrative lives entirely in the sandbox you build. This frees players from the pressure of meeting predefined story beats, allowing moments of whimsy—like a Sea-Monkey race or a sudden burst of pearl harvesting—to feel organic. It’s a different storytelling model, but for fans of creativity and personalization, it can be deeply rewarding.
Overall Experience
The Amazing Virtual Sea-Monkeys excels as a tranquil pet simulation that welcomes both casual gamers and dedicated hobbyists. Its straightforward mechanics and lack of complex AI make it immediately accessible, while the pearl-based progression system provides gentle incentives to return regularly. You won’t find intense challenges or dramatic plot twists here, but if you’re looking for a stress-free way to spend your free time, this game delivers.
Replayability comes from experimentation: mix and match tank decorations, watch how your Sea-Monkeys respond to different stimuli, and aim to collect every add-on in the in-game store. The absence of a rigid goal structure might put off players craving traditional objectives, but those who appreciate open-ended simulations will find ample motivation in the pursuit of a thriving microscopic world.
Ultimately, The Amazing Virtual Sea-Monkeys is a delightful ode to the quirky appeal of miniature pets. It captures the essence of nurturing life in its simplest form, wrapped in an inviting package of colorful visuals and easygoing gameplay. If you’ve ever wondered what it would be like to care for Sea-Monkeys—without the hassle of real-world cyclops brine shrimp—this charming virtual tank is well worth exploring.
